What Does It Mean to Be Named a Super Lawyer?
Super Lawyers is a rating service published by Thomson Reuters that identifies attorneys who have distinguished themselves in their practice areas. The selection process is rigorous. It involves peer nominations, independent research, and a multiphase evaluation of each candidate’s professional achievements, reputation, and standing within the legal community. Only about five percent of eligible attorneys in New York earn the designation in any given year.
This is not a pay-to-play list. Attorneys cannot buy their way onto it. The Super Lawyers selection process is designed to identify lawyers who have attained a high degree of peer recognition and professional achievement.
